In that same ACR update I mentioned in another thread, I also saw this notice about the Jalapeno Ketchup being discontinued completely because of spoilage concerns:
For DSCP Website Posting

AMSRD-NSC-CF-F (Norton/5356)
1 November 2007

TO: DSCP-FTRAA (Malason/7772)

SUBJECT: ES08-008; Deletion of Jalapeno Ketchup from MRE 27; ACR-M-027 and MRE 28, ACR-M-028

Date received: 31 Oct 07
Date due: 7 Nov 07
Date replied: 1 Nov 07

1. At the MRE Workshop, it was observed that one lot of Jalapeno Ketchup, produced by Boca Grande Foods, exhibited swollen packages. Microbiological testing revealed a high yeast count, which may accelerate spoilage.

2. Based on these results, a decision to delete Jalapeno Ketchup from the MRE 27 and MRE 28 menus was reached. In MRE 27, there will be no replacement item. In MRE 28, Menu 18 will now have a Barbecue Sauce.

3. ACR-M-027, Table I, delete:

“Ketchup, Flavored, Jalapeno, Medium
A-A-20346, Flavor V, Style B, Packaging Type 5”

Table II, Menu 5, delete: “Jalapeno ketchup”

4. ACR-M-028, Table I, delete:

“Ketchup, Flavored, Jalapeno, Medium
A-A-20346, Flavor V, Style B, Packaging Type 5”

Table II, Menu 18:
Delete: “Jalapeno ketchup” and sub “Barbecue sauce”.

5. These changes have been incorporated into the Meal, Ready-to-Eat (MRE), Assembly Requirements documents and Change 05, dated 1 Nov 07, for ACR-M-027, and Change 03, dated 1 Nov 07, for ACR-M-028, are attached.
So watch out for that Jalapeno Ketchup if you have any from the 2007 MREs!

I just had some of that last week in a 2006 chicken breast meal. No swelling of the pouch.

There was nothing wrong with it except that they put jalapeno flavoring in it for God knows why. I would much prefer plain ketchup, but Natick still refuses to acknowledge that Americans love plain ketchup.
